Governance & Funding

Quintile Classification

Imboniselo Primary School is classified as a Q1 school, which means it serves the most economically disadvantaged communities and receives the highest per-learner government allocation under the National Norms and Standards for School Funding.

Fee Status

As a Q1 institution, Imboniselo Primary School is designated as a no-fee school. Parents and guardians are not required to pay school fees, ensuring that financial circumstances do not bar learners from accessing quality education.

Section 21 Status

Imboniselo Primary School is a Section 21 school, meaning the School Governing Body (SGB) manages its own budget. This financial autonomy allows the school to make independent decisions regarding maintenance, school fund, curriculum, supplies, other without direct provincial administration.

Enrollment & Staffing

For the 2025 academic year, Imboniselo Primary School reported a total enrollment of 1,398 learners with a teaching staff of 40 educators. This translates to a learner-to-educator ratio of 35:1, reflecting a moderate class size typical of South African schools.

Source: Department of Basic Education Annual Snap Survey (2025). Learner and educator counts are as reported by the institution.

History & Background

Imboniselo Primary School was historically administered under the Department Of Education & Training(det) education department. Today, the school operates as a non-discriminatory public institution under the Western Cape Department of Education.
